<?php
namespace Drupal\Test\jquery_colorpicker\Element;
use Drupal\Core\Form\FormStateInterface;
use Drupal\Tests\UnitTestCase;
use Drupal\jquery_colorpicker\Element\JQueryColorpicker;
class JQueryColorpickerTest extends UnitTestCase {
public function testValueCallback($expected, $input) {
$element = [];
$form_state = $this
->prophesize(FormStateInterface::class)
->reveal();
$this
->assertSame($expected, JQueryColorpicker::valueCallback($element, $input, $form_state));
}
public function providerTestValueCallback() {
$data = [];
$data[] = [
NULL,
FALSE,
];
$data[] = [
NULL,
NULL,
];
$data[] = [
'',
[
'test',
],
];
$test = new \stdClass();
$test->value = 'test';
$data[] = [
'',
$test,
];
$data[] = [
"123",
123,
];
$data[] = [
"1.23",
1.23,
];
$data[] = [
"123",
"123",
];
$data[] = [
"1",
TRUE,
];
return $data;
}
public function testValidateElementEmpty() {
$element = [
'#value' => '',
];
$form_state = $this
->prophesize(FormStateInterface::class)
->reveal();
$this
->assertSame(NULL, JQueryColorpicker::validateElement($element, $form_state));
}
}
